About
Game adaptation of Horizon in the Middle of Nowhere exclusive to the PSP in Japan. The game is an RPG, the story is partially based on the anime and the novels but also includes an original scenario, with more than 80 characters from both media making an appearance. The game sold more than 26,000 copies in its first week after launch.
